Description
Bobby is eager to join the orchestra but knows nothing about it. Luckily, Strauss the Conductor is here to teach him before he signs up. Through the antics of these two engaging puppet characters this program teaches students about the woodwind and brass sections of the orchestra. It explores the history and development of ancient aerophones to the modern day flute, clarinet, oboe, bassoon, trumpet, French horn, trombone, and tuba, and demonstrates a range of playing techniques and varying timbres.
